Peptide therapy offers another powerful avenue for systemic recalibration. These short chains of amino acids function as cellular messengers, delivering specific instructions to various biological systems. When the threat detector floods the system with stress signals, it can disrupt cellular repair, energy production, and recovery. Peptides can directly address these disruptions.

For instance, growth hormone-releasing peptides (GHRPs) such as Ipamorelin or CJC-1295 stimulate the pulsatile release of natural growth hormone. This amplifies cellular regeneration, enhances sleep quality, and supports fat metabolism, all critical for countering the effects of chronic stress. This approach promotes the body’s natural restorative mechanisms.

Other peptides, like BPC-157, exert profound regenerative effects, particularly on the gut and musculoskeletal system. A chronically active threat detector often compromises gut integrity, contributing to systemic inflammation. BPC-157 supports healing of the gut lining, fortifying a critical barrier against inflammatory triggers. This direct cellular repair mechanism assists in quieting the internal alarm bells.

Another powerful example involves Thymosin Beta 4, a peptide celebrated for its role in tissue repair and immune modulation. An overactive stress response can suppress immune function. Targeted peptide support helps fortify the body’s defenses, allowing it to recover more effectively from daily stressors. Glossary

human performance

Meaning ∞ Human Performance refers to the measurable capacity of an individual to execute physical, cognitive, and physiological tasks efficiently, often benchmarked against an established standard or potential.

body composition

Meaning ∞ Body Composition refers to the relative amounts of fat mass versus lean mass, specifically muscle, bone, and water, within the human organism, which is a critical metric beyond simple body weight.

anabolic processes

Meaning ∞ Anabolic processes are the constructive metabolic activities that build larger, more complex molecules from smaller units, a necessary function for growth, maintenance, and storage within the organism.

physiological stress

Meaning ∞ Physiological Stress denotes any internal or external stimulus that disrupts homeostasis, demanding a coordinated adaptive response from the body's regulatory systems, notably the HPA axis.

cognitive clarity

Meaning ∞ Cognitive Clarity is the measurable state of high-level executive function characterized by focused attention, efficient information processing, and unimpaired memory recall, reflecting an optimally supported central nervous system.

sleep quality

Meaning ∞ Sleep Quality is a multifaceted metric assessing the restorative efficacy of sleep, encompassing aspects like sleep latency, duration, continuity, and the depth of sleep stages achieved.
